The PRAXIS Music exam is a content knowledge assessment required for teacher certification in music education across most states, including Ohio. If you're pursuing a career as a music teacher in Dayton or elsewhere, you'll need to pass this exam as part of your state certification requirements. The test covers music theory, history, pedagogy, and listening skills, making it essential to demonstrate comprehensive knowledge of the field.

Many test-takers struggle with the aural/listening component, which requires identifying intervals, chords, and musical styles by ear—skills that are difficult to practice alone. Music history and theory integration also trip up candidates who studied these subjects separately. Personalized tutoring helps you connect these concepts and build targeted listening skills through focused practice with immediate feedback.

Yes—ear training is one of the areas where personalized instruction makes the biggest difference. A tutor can systematically build your skills by starting with foundational intervals and chords, then progressing to more complex harmonic progressions and orchestral identification. Regular, targeted listening practice with expert feedback helps you develop the auditory discrimination needed for the exam's listening section.
